Sexual Abuse / Assault
If you are in danger please call triple zero (000). It is important that you find a safe place that you can go to, whether it's a friend's place, a refuge or the police station.
Here are a list of support organisations to contact where you can get help even if you don't report a crime to the police.
Australia wide
- Call 1800 RESPECT (1800 737 732) for confidential information, counselling and support on sexual assault, domestic or family violence and abuse. You can chat online and find services in your area.

Find a counsellor or psychologist in Australia
When looking for a therapist, check their credentials to ensure that they are trauma informed and know how to deal with sexual assault and abuse.
